地址:https://www.mysql.com/



解压下载的文件

配置环境变量
新建系统变量
变量名:MYSQL_HOME
变量值:解压 mysql-5.7.24-winx64.zip 后的路径

编辑系统变量
变量名:Path
变量值:添加 %MYSQL_HOME%in

在解压后的文件夹中新建一个my.txt文件,然后通过重命名修改文件后缀为.ini

文件的内容如下:
[client]
port=3306
default-character-set=utf8
[mysqld]
# 设置为MySQL解压后的路径
basedir=E:Softwaremysql-5.7.24-winx64
datadir=E:Softwaremysql-5.7.24-winx64data
port=3306
character_set_server=utf8
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
以管理员身份打开cmd命令窗口,切换到MySQL安装目录的bin目录下,执行mysqld -install命令进行安装

执行mysqld --initialize-insecure --user=mysql命令初始化

原因:my.ini文件格式是utf-8
解决办法:my.ini文件保存为ANSI格式文件
执行net start mysql命令启动MySQL
启动成功,执行"mysqladmin -u root -p password"命令设置密码,root旧密码为空,直接回车就可以

mysql-5.7.24-winx64 解压版安装完毕
测试是否安装成功:执行 mysql -u root -p 登陆MySQL

执行 select now(); 查询当前时间
